    Velocity aurora blvd is in San Juan. Across a Caltex station, between A. Juan and R Lagmay- that's before the J Ruiz LRT station if coming from cubao.
    But there's a better one, recommended in this forum, that's just past the LRT station. Forgot the name...

    Really? Right now, I have this so-called TEMS (Toyota Electronically Modulated Suspension) shocks at the front. It's fluid type but the softness/hardness can be adjusted by the touch of a switch. I think they just lack fluid and are not worn out because they can still be hard or soft. My problem is that the front tends to bottom out (as in you feel like punched on the butt hard) when it hits something like an embossed manhole.

    This Zee shop seems promising, but I hope the repair won't cost as much as new shocks.
